Creating a Thanksgiving Harvest Centerpiece: Adding Rustic Charm to Your Table

Thanksgiving is a time to gather with loved ones and celebrate the abundance of the harvest. One way to enhance the festive atmosphere is by creating a stunning Thanksgiving harvest centerpiece. This rustic piece can serve as the focal point of your table, bringing the beauty of fall indoors and adding a touch of natural elegance to your celebration.

Choosing the Right Materials

The first step in crafting your Thanksgiving centerpiece is selecting materials that reflect the essence of the season. Consider incorporating elements such as dried wheat stalks, mini pumpkins, gourds, and autumn leaves. These natural items not only embody the fall harvest but also add texture and color to your arrangement.

Incorporating Fresh Elements

While dried materials provide a sturdy base, fresh flowers and greenery can bring vibrancy and life to your centerpiece. Consider using sunflowers, eucalyptus, or even cranberries for a pop of color. Be sure to select flowers that complement the color palette of your table setting.

Arranging Your Centerpiece

Begin by placing a base layer of greenery in a shallow bowl or basket. This will serve as the foundation for your arrangement. Next, add larger items like pumpkins or gourds, balancing them throughout the display. Finally, tuck in smaller pieces such as berries, flowers, and leaves to fill in any gaps and create a cohesive look.

Maintaining Your Centerpiece

To ensure your centerpiece lasts throughout the holiday, keep it in a cool, dry place when not in use. If you’ve included fresh flowers, change the water regularly and trim the stems to prolong their life. By taking these simple steps, your centerpiece will remain beautiful from Thanksgiving dinner through the weekend.
